The average output of a compressed air canister varies depending on its size and design, but typically, a standard 10-ounce (300 ml) canister can produce around 2 to 5 minutes of continuous air flow. The pressure can range from 60 to 100 psi, depending on the specific canister. These canisters are often used for cleaning electronics, inflating items, or powering pneumatic tools. Always check the specifications on the canister for precise output information.

The compressor compresses air and send it to either a wet tank or directly to the air dryer. Oil and moisture in the compressed air are absorbed by the desiccant in the air dryer canister. When the compressor signals cut out, it also send a signal to the dryer to open the purge valve, which purges the canister.
When air cans are used for a long time, the rapid release of compressed air causes the canister to cool down due to the decrease in pressure inside the canister. This cooling effect is a result of the gas expanding rapidly and absorbing heat from its surroundings, making the canister feel cold to the touch.

The energy content of compressed air is typically measured in terms of energy density, which is lower compared to other energy storage technologies such as batteries or gasoline. The energy content of compressed air is dependent on the pressure at which it is stored and the volume of the storage vessel. Compressed air is often used as a form of energy storage in applications where high power output and short duration energy release are required.

A compressed air dryer is used to remove moisture from compressed air to prevent corrosion, damage to equipment, and contamination of processes. By reducing the moisture content in the compressed air, the dryer helps ensure the efficiency and reliability of pneumatic systems.
